Dating back to the 17th century, the Swan Hotel is a sizeable building of immense character and charm. It is predominantly arranged over three storeys, with long two-storeyed wings forming two sides of the rear courtyard. The building includes an array of period features throughout, such as high ceilings, exposed timbers, sash/leaded windows and inglenook fireplaces.
The ground floor entrance lobby opens into the guest lounge and provides access to the first floor hotel rooms, front meeting room (c. 10), basement cellar and main bar. Heavily timbered, the main bar features a superb inglenook fireplace and a part-brick bar servery, catering for c. 40 covers. A store room is located to the back and toilet block to the front, with Male, female and accessible WCs. Beyond the bar is the restaurant dining room for c. 25 covers, fireplace and doors opening onto the delightful 'secret' trade garden. A hallway leads to the commercial trade kitchen, replete with a range of equipment and generous in size, with ancillary storage and prep areas. To the rear is the sizeable function room with carvery and bar, capable of accommodating over 100 covers and including male and female WCs. Completing the ground floor is a further meeting room, which is currently let and operating as a pop-up shop.
The letting rooms are located on the first and second floors and comprise 12 double/twin rooms plus 2 family rooms, all of which are en suite. There is a further owner/manager's room, which is also en suite.
Outiside, there is a sizeable dedicated car park to the rear which is accessed via Swan Lane and has space for c. 30 vehicles and three garage which are tucked away in the rear corner. A courtyard provides an outdoor trading area and includes a sheltered area with tables for c. 12 covers.
